Position Overview

The Applications Engineer works directly with Siemens EDA customers to help grow the adoption and use of Siemens' Solido software in their simulation, characterization, and verification flows. This position combines technical depth with strong communication skills and an appreciation for the business value delivered by Siemens EDA products. The Applications Engineer manages multiple customer engagements concurrently and must be very effective at customer relationships. This customer interface is not only at the engineering level, but first or second level management as well. The Applications Engineer must align closely with the account team to help them meet and exceed quotas as they proactively manage customer accounts to success. This could include account planning and developing solutions to customer problems, ultimately resulting in product revenue growth. Success involves working as a team with sales, marketing, and R&D organizations. No prior experience in the semiconductor industry or as an Applications Engineer is required. You will receive on the job training to help you develop all the domain skills you need.

Responsibilities

As an Applications Engineer, you work with account teams to drive adoption of Siemens' Solido products (Solido Variation Designer, Solido Characterization Suite, Solido Crosscheck). This includes, but is not limited to, the following activities:

  • Work together with technology experts at major semiconductor companies to understand their challenges and help them use Solido products to solve those challenges.
  • Illustrate the value Siemens EDA brings to customers by assisting them in their evaluations of Siemens' Solido software; developing and delivering software demonstrations and technical presentations; performing benchmark evaluations for customers.
  • Execute on pre‑sales and post‑sales technical activities, including assessments of how company products meet customer needs, the preparation of product specifications for development and installation of customized applications/solutions, and technical support for sales presentations and product demonstrations.
  • Drive business for Solido products, using technical expertise and working directly with customers at the appropriate management level to establish criteria for successful engagements.
  • Assist technical teams, including Solido R&D, to establish value for Solido products and differentiate from the competition.
  • Work closely with Solido R&D to address customer feedback and requests.
  • Contribute towards the product technical sales plan with management and communicate frequently with peers and management on progress and account status.
